Output 8876eb33ba194c4278655e6f211e6f4735f8c8549496ef175c1753ec4e7075d1:6

value
165560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e70e5e425427b06e31cf15d5d1e2b899dc1b540 OP_EQUAL
address
3QtNoZSTDZYoyyE1d2z6UUem9vyQBmn4at
transaction
8876eb33ba194c4278655e6f211e6f4735f8c8549496ef175c1753ec4e7075d1
spent
true